PARLIAMENTARY ELECTION ACT 1978

Section 26A(1)(b)

 

BYE-ELECTION CONSTITUENCY 17

(PEMBROKE CENTRAL)

 

NOTICE OF PUBLICATION OF PARLIAMENTARY REGISTER

 

Notice is given that, in accordance with section 26A(1)(b) of the Parliamentary Election Act 1978, copies of the parliamentary register (“the register”)  for constituency 17 Pembroke Central are available from Tuesday, 29 October 2019 for inspection at the Parliamentary Registry, Craig Appin House 3rd floor, # 8 Wesley Street, Hamilton, the General Post Office in Hamilton, and at the Hamilton Police Station.

Objections to the registration of any person whose name is entered on the register must be delivered to the Parliamentary Registrar not later than seven days after the publication of the register.  The grounds for such objections must be in writing and accompanied by a deposit of five dollars ($5).

Objections by a person that his name has been irregularly omitted from the register or that particulars relating to his name are incomplete or inaccurate must be delivered to the Parliamentary Registrar not later than seven days after the publication of the register.  The grounds for such objections must be in writing and accompanied by a deposit of five dollars ($5).
